Yes, at German discount supermarkets, you can purchase a do-it-yourself 'Balkonsolar' system and battery. Simply plug it in and you're ready to go.
However, Aldi Australia offers complete systems: 6 kW solar, a 5.5 kW inverter and a 10 kWh LFP battery, fully installed for AU$7,000 (€4,000)!

After canceling the development of the N1 Moon rocket in 1974, the USSR did not give up the goal of building a super-heavy rocket. But, starting with a clean sheet of paper, it took more than a decade for the Soviet engineers to field the Energia rocket, which made the two largely successful flights in 1987 and 1988. At the beginning of the 1990s, Russian rocket engineers watching with horror the demise of the magnificent Energia-Buran program under the crumbling Soviet economy made a last-ditch attempt to save its unique technological heritage within the Energia-M rocket. While much smaller and cheaper than the original 2,400-ton Energia, the Energia-M would preserve all key components, launch infrastructure and experience of the USSR's largest space project...
